Internet Culture: Uncovering the Hidden Gems of Memes and Viral Cultural References

The internet has produced a unique culture where millions of people come together to share, create, and consume digital content. One of the most fascinating aspects of internet culture is the world of memes and viral cultural references. These hidden gems of internet culture give us a glimpse into the online community’s sense of humor, creativity, and shared experiences.

Memes are a form of cultural expression that spread rapidly across the internet. They can take the form of images, videos, or phrases that are often accompanied by humor, satire, or social commentary. Memes are shared and reshared, evolving as they are passed from person to person. Some memes become so popular that they are recognized and understood by a wide audience, while others remain niche or cater to specific communities.

Viral cultural references are similar to memes in that they are shared widely across the internet, but they often go beyond humor to tap into shared experiences and emotions. These references can come from popular videos, songs, or iconic moments in pop culture that gain new life on the internet through remixes, parodies, and reinterpretations.

Both memes and viral cultural references have become an important part of the internet culture, influencing the way people communicate, interact, and engage with digital content. They serve as a form of shorthand for internet users, allowing them to reference shared experiences and inside jokes without having to explain the context.

The power of memes and viral cultural references goes beyond just entertainment—they can also have a significant impact on society and politics. Memes have been used to raise awareness of social issues, criticize political figures, and even start movements. Viral references, on the other hand, can influence the way people perceive and interpret real-world events, often shaping the public discourse and collective memory.

Despite their widespread influence, memes and viral cultural references often remain relatively unknown to those who are not actively engaged in internet culture. For many people, the internet is a vast and overwhelming space, and it can be easy to miss out on the hidden gems that make up its unique culture.

So, how can we uncover these hidden gems of internet culture? The key is to actively seek out and engage with online communities and platforms where memes and viral references are created and shared. Social media platforms like Reddit, Twitter, and TikTok are hotbeds for viral content, while meme-focused websites such as Know Your Meme and meme subreddits offer a deep dive into the world of internet humor.

Engaging with internet culture is not only about consuming content, but also about actively participating in the creation and sharing of memes and viral references. By joining online communities and contributing to the conversation, we can gain a deeper understanding of internet culture and discover the hidden gems that make it so unique.

As internet culture continues to evolve, so too will the world of memes and viral cultural references. By staying curious and engaged with the ever-changing landscape of the internet, we can continue to uncover the hidden gems that shape our online experiences and collective digital culture.

From Basilicas to Monasteries: Exploring the Treasures of Christian Land

Christianity has played a significant role in shaping the history and culture of many countries around the world. From ancient basilicas to secluded monasteries, the treasures of Christian land are a testament to the enduring legacy of the faith.

Basilicas, with their grand architecture and rich history, are an iconic symbol of Christianity. These large, ornate buildings are often built in the shape of a Latin cross and are typically the seat of a bishop. One of the most famous basilicas in the world is St. Peter’s Basilica in Vatican City, which is considered the holiest Christian site and the center of the Catholic Church. Another notable basilica is the Basilica of the Sacred Heart in Paris, known for its stunning mosaics and breathtaking views of the city.

But beyond the grandeur of basilicas, there are also hidden treasures to be found in the quiet and contemplative world of monasteries. These secluded religious communities are often located in scenic and remote locations, providing a peaceful retreat for monks and nuns to devote themselves to a life of prayer and contemplation. Monasteries are also repositories of art and culture, with many containing exquisite frescoes, paintings, and manuscripts that have been preserved for centuries.

One such monastery is the Monastery of St. Catherine in Egypt, situated at the foot of Mount Sinai. This ancient monastery is one of the oldest Christian monasteries in the world and is home to a rich collection of religious artifacts, including the purported burning bush from the biblical story of Moses. The Monastery of Montserrat in Spain is another notable site, known for its stunning mountain setting and revered statue of the Black Madonna.

Exploring the treasures of Christian land allows visitors to delve into the rich history and spirituality of the faith. Whether wandering the hallowed halls of a basilica or meditating in the peaceful gardens of a monastery, these sacred sites offer a unique glimpse into the spiritual heritage of Christianity. As the saying goes, “To travel is to discover; to discover is to find oneself.” And in exploring the treasures of Christian land, one may indeed find a deeper connection to their faith and a renewed sense of wonder at the enduring legacy of Christianity.

Christian Land and Global Tourism: A Harmonious Coexistence

Christian land and global tourism can coexist harmoniously, bringing about mutual benefit for both parties. The presence of Christian sites in various parts of the world has always been a draw for tourists seeking to deepen their religious faith or simply to admire the beauty and historical significance of these locations. At the same time, the influx of tourists can bring economic opportunities and cultural exchange to these regions, ultimately contributing to their growth and development.

One of the most famous Christian sites in the world is the Vatican City, the seat of the Roman Catholic Church and home to numerous historical and religious treasures. Millions of tourists flock to the Vatican every year to visit St. Peter’s Basilica, the Sistine Chapel, and other iconic landmarks. This surge in tourism has brought significant economic benefits to the city-state, with revenues from entry fees, guided tours, and souvenir sales helping to support the upkeep of these historic sites.

Similarly, other Christian sites around the world, such as the Wailing Wall in Jerusalem, the Cathedral of Notre Dame in Paris, and the Basilica of Our Lady of Guadalupe in Mexico City, also attract millions of visitors each year. These sites not only provide spiritual enrichment for believers but also serve as vital cultural landmarks and tourist attractions that help to boost the local economy.

However, the impact of tourism on Christian sites can be both positive and negative. While increased foot traffic can bring in much-needed revenue and international exposure, it can also lead to overcrowding, environmental degradation, and the commercialization of sacred spaces. Striking a balance between preserving the sanctity of these sites and welcoming tourists with open arms is essential to ensure their long-term sustainability and integrity.

One way to achieve this balance is through responsible tourism practices that prioritize sustainability, authenticity, and respect for local customs and traditions. Tour operators and visitors alike can make a conscious effort to minimize their impact on Christian sites by following designated paths, refraining from touching or disturbing religious artifacts, and refraining from taking photographs in sensitive areas.

Additionally, local communities and religious authorities can work together to implement regulations and guidelines that promote the preservation and protection of these sites, while also leveraging tourism as a means of cultural exchange and interfaith dialogue. By fostering a spirit of mutual respect and understanding, Christian land and global tourism can coexist harmoniously, enriching both visitors and host communities in the process.

Healing the Soul: The Transformative Power of Christian Pilgrimage

For centuries, Christians have embarked on pilgrimages as a way to deepen their faith, connect with God, and seek healing for their souls. Whether it be walking the Camino de Santiago in Spain, visiting the Holy Land in Israel, or journeying to the site of a miraculous apparition, a pilgrimage can be a transformative experience that brings peace, clarity, and renewal to the spirit.

One of the key aspects of a Christian pilgrimage is the physical journey itself. Walking or traveling to a holy site forces the pilgrim to slow down, disconnect from the distractions of daily life, and focus on their inner self. This intentional act of leaving behind the comforts of home and embarking on a journey of faith can be a powerful way to foster self-reflection, prayer, and spiritual growth.

Along the way, pilgrims often encounter challenges and obstacles that test their commitment and faith. Whether it be physical discomfort, inclement weather, or interpersonal conflicts, these challenges can serve as opportunities for the pilgrim to strengthen their resolve, cultivate patience, and practice forgiveness. Through perseverance and trust in God, pilgrims learn to surrender control and open themselves to the transformative power of the journey.

Another key element of Christian pilgrimage is the sense of community and fellowship that emerges among pilgrims. Sharing the road with fellow travelers, exchanging stories, and offering support and encouragement can create a sense of camaraderie that deepens connections and fosters a sense of unity. Through this shared experience, pilgrims can find comfort and solace in knowing that they are not alone in their spiritual journey.

In addition to the physical and emotional aspects of a pilgrimage, the act of visiting a sacred site holds symbolic significance for many Christians. The place itself, whether it be a church, shrine, or natural landmark, is imbued with spiritual energy and significance that can inspire reverence, awe, and a sense of presence. By engaging in acts of prayer, meditation, and contemplation at these sacred sites, pilgrims can draw closer to God and experience a profound sense of peace and healing.

Ultimately, a Christian pilgrimage is a transformative journey of faith that offers the opportunity for spiritual growth, renewal, and healing of the soul. Through the physical journey, challenges, community, and encounter with the sacred, pilgrims can deepen their connection to God, cultivate inner peace, and experience a sense of wholeness and well-being. It is a profound and life-changing experience that can nourish the spirit and awaken the soul to new possibilities and potential.
